Compensation at Adverum Biotechnologies Amidst Investor Concerns


Posted: 05/05/2025 03:40 am


Adverum Biotechnologies, Inc. (NASDAQ: ADVM), a company operating in the biological products sector, has recently found itself in the spotlight due to two concurrent narratives: executive compensation and growing investor scrutiny. At the forefront of this financial year’s discussion is Laurent Fischer, the company's President and Chief Executive Officer, whose total compensation for 2024 reached an impressive $4,131,290. This package predominantly consisted of a $2,839,252 option award, complemented by smaller allocations for salary, stock awards, and incentive plan compensation^1.

The compensation strategy at Adverum illustrates an emphasis on variable incentives rather than fixed salaries, a common approach to align executive interests with long-term company performance. Laurent Fischer’s salary, for instance, accounted for approximately 16% of his total compensation, showing a significant reliance on performance-based rewards^1. This method aligns leadership’s success with shareholders' interests theoretically, suggesting a focus on long-term value creation.

However, recent seconds of this strategy is compounded by a backdrop of investor concerns and legal investigations. Multiple law firms, including Pomerantz LLP and Bronstein, Gewirtz & Grossman, LLC, are scrutinizing Adverum for potential claims on behalf of investors^2. The nature of these claims could significantly impact the perception of corporate governance and management efficacy at Adverum. Such probes often cast a long shadow on companies, raising questions about operational transparency and ethical practices.

These investigations arrive amid challenges reflected in the company’s market performance. Despite a modest 4.80% rise to $3.49, Adverum's stock price remains significantly below its year high of $10.84, hinting at underlying market apprehensions^3. The firm’s current earnings per share (EPS) stands at -6.62, further illuminating financial hurdles that might overshadow the compensation structures that encourage executive performance aligned with company growth.

Setareh Seyedkazemi, the Chief Development Officer, received a lower total compensation of $799,362 in 2023, reflecting the varying compensation structures across different roles within the company. Notably, these packages signal how companies balance executive incentives amidst fiscal challenges^1. Seyedkazemi's package included no stock awards, with option awards and incentive compensation forming a smaller portion than those seen in Fischer’s package^1.

The wider industry context has seen fluctuating stock prices, and Adverum is not immune to such volatilities. With a market cap of approximately $72.9 million and a volume of 756,161 shares traded, Adverum's trading dynamics reveal a company currently navigating through a turbulent financial phase^3. As Adverum approaches its next earnings announcement, stakeholders will be keenly observing these elements of compensation structures and scrutinizing their effectiveness in stabilizing and potentially enhancing company prospects in the long run.

Through a lens of principled compensation and thorough scrutiny, Adverum Biotechnologies stands at a critical juncture. Stakeholder perception, largely influenced by executive incentives and external investigation outcomes, will play a pivotal role in determining the company's path ahead.
